Daily Operations• KRP NO. 29 “Morning Reports”

– Daily contact with Dam Superintendents– SCADA

• Reservoir Conditions• Alarm System• Gate Changes

– HYDROMET• Diversion Dam Conditions• Streamflows• Updated hourly on GOES sites• Daily for Reservoir Conditions (Morning Reports)

Daily Operations Cont.

• Gate Changes– SCADA controlled facilities– Harlan County– Scheduling (8-24 hrs in advance)

Annual Operating Plans

– Table 4 Operation Estimates• Reasonable Minimum Inflow• Most Probable Inflow• Reasonable Maximum Inflow

– Summary of Operations

District Water Supply Estimates

• January Water Supply Estimates– Based on AOP Table 4 Operation Estimates– Current Reservoir Conditions– Drought Predictions– Observed Streamflow Conditions– River Transit Efficiency (historic)– District Delivery Efficiency (historic)

Challenges

• Diminishing Inflows– SW Nebraska Area Lakes– Correlation with Precipitation– Variability

• Compact Administration– Imported Waters from Colorado– Future Administration Actions?
